Using Household Solutions

Before resorting to commercial cleaning products, consider these readily available household solutions, often effective for removing light to moderate scuff marks.

1. Baking Soda Paste: Baking soda is a gentle abrasive that can effectively lift scuff marks from vinyl flooring. Create a paste by mixing baking soda with a small amount of water. Apply the paste to the scuff mark and gently rub it in circular motions using a soft cloth. Leave the paste on the surface for a few minutes before wiping it away with a damp cloth. Rinse the area thoroughly and dry it completely.

2. White Vinegar: White vinegar is a natural cleaning agent that can effectively remove stains and grime. Dilute white vinegar with water in a 1:1 ratio and pour it into a spray bottle. Spray the solution directly onto the scuff marks and let it sit for a few minutes. Gently scrub the marks using a soft cloth and rinse thoroughly.

3. Toothpaste: Non-gel toothpaste can act as a mild abrasive to remove scuff marks from vinyl flooring. Apply a small amount of toothpaste to a soft cloth and gently rub it onto the scuff mark. Work in circular motions, applying gentle pressure. Rinse the area thoroughly with water and dry it completely.

Specialized Cleaning Products

If household remedies fail to remove stubborn scuff marks, consider utilizing specialized cleaning products formulated for vinyl flooring. These products often contain ingredients that effectively break down stubborn stains and restore the shine to the floor.

1. Vinyl Floor Cleaner: Vinyl floor cleaners are readily available at most hardware stores and supermarkets. These cleaners are specifically designed for removing dirt, grime, and scuff marks from vinyl surfaces. Follow the instructions on the product label.

2. Magic Eraser: Magic Erasers are melamine foam products known for their ability to remove stubborn stains and scuff marks. Moisten a Magic Eraser with water and gently rub it onto the scuff mark. Avoid excessive pressure, as it can scratch the vinyl surface.

Prevention Tips

Preventing scuff marks from occurring in the first place is crucial for maintaining the beauty and longevity of your vinyl flooring. Simple measures can significantly minimize the risk of scuff marks.

1. Use Floor Mats: Place floor mats at entry points, such as doors and hallways, to catch dirt and debris, reducing the amount of foot traffic that can lead to scuff marks.

2. Place Protective Pads: Utilize furniture pads under the legs of furniture, especially heavy items, to prevent scratching and scuffing as they are moved.

3. Regularly Clean: Regularly cleaning your vinyl flooring with a damp mop or vacuum cleaner helps prevent dust and dirt from accumulating and causing scuff marks.

By following these methods and prevention tips, you can effectively eliminate scuff marks from your vinyl flooring and ensure its lasting beauty and shine. Remember to always test any cleaning solution on a small, inconspicuous area before applying it to the entire floor.
